Location : Canada (Remote-friendly)
Start date : ASAP
Languages : English (required), French (strong plus)
About the Role
Pragmatike is hiring on behalf of a fast-growing, product-driven technology company building data-intensive platforms used at scale across multiple markets. The product focuses on automation, data extraction, and intelligent workflows, with a strong emphasis on backend reliability and speed of execution.
Were looking for a Full-Stack Engineer (backend-leaning) who can take ownership of features end to end. The role is approximately 70% backend and 30% frontend , ideal for engineers who enjoy deep backend work while staying close to product delivery.
What Youll Do
- Design, build, and maintain backend services using Python and Node.js
- Own APIs, business logic, and data flows backed by PostgreSQL and MongoDB
- Contribute to frontend features (~30%) to deliver complete product experiences
- Build and maintain web scraping and data ingestion pipelines (where legally and ethically applicable)
- Work efficiently using AI-assisted / vibe coding tools (Cursor, Copilot, etc.)
- Collaborate closely with product and engineering to translate requirements into scalable solutions
- Improve performance, reliability, and maintainability of existing systems
- Participate in technical decision-making and architecture discussions
What Were Looking For
4+ years of experience in Full-Stack or Backend EngineeringStrong backend experience with Python and / or Node.jsSolid knowledge of PostgreSQL and MongoDBComfortable contributing to frontend codebases when requiredExperience or interest in scraping and data-heavy systemsFamiliarity with modern AI-assisted development workflowsStrong ownership mindset and ability to work autonomouslyEligible to work in CanadaBonus Points
French fluency or professional working proficiencyExperience with OCR, computer vision, or document processingBackground in automation-heavy or data-driven productsStartup or scale-up experienceWhy This Role Will Pivot Your Career
High ownership over production featuresDirect impact on core backend systemsExposure to automation, scraping, and intelligent workflowsDaily use of modern AI-assisted development toolsClear growth path in a product-focused engineering teamTechnology Stack
Backend : Python, Node.jsDatabases : PostgreSQL, MongoDBFrontend : Modern JavaScript frameworksData : Scraping, ingestion pipelinesBonus : OCR, computer visionBenefits
Competitive salary based on Canadian market benchmarksRemote-friendly within CanadaFlexible working hoursHigh-autonomy engineering rolePragmatike is dedicated to a fair, transparent, and inclusive recruitment process. We ensure that no applicant is discriminated against based on age, disability, gender, gender identity or expression, marital or civil partner status, pregnancy or maternity, race, religion or belief, sex, or sexual orientation. In accordance with the General Data Protection Regulation (GDPR), your personal data will be processed lawfully, fairly, and securely. We collect and use your personal data solely for recruitment purposes, including sharing it with our client(s) for employment consideration. You have the right to request access, correction, or deletion of your data at any time. We are committed to maintaining the confidentiality and security of your information throughout the recruitment process.